    I can help with the video card drivers:

    you'll need to download and install the nvidia driver for your video card
    after you download, you need to edit your inittab file and set runlevel to 3,
    this will give you a command prompt when you reboot. you'll need to login as root then run the install script.

    once installed, telinit 5 to get to desktop.
